## Annual Billing Transition (Managers Only)

From next quarter, the Fernhollow platform moves to annual billing as the default for all new contracts. Monthly plans remain available only with a 10% uplift and director approval. Existing customers convert at renewal; early-switch incentives apply through Q2. Sales leads should update quote templates accordingly and route exceptions through the deal desk. The commercial motivation is outlined here.

board note of bajop-yaweg: The western region missed its Pelys quota by 58.0 percent last quarter. Pelysek Foods plans to raise the Belius list price by 44.0 percent in July. The steering committee signed off on a budget of $133.8 million for Project Pelax. The renewal with Zoraelix Systems closes at $61.9 million a year, 12.7 percent above the last contract.

Ticket: Staging env misconfigured for Siftgate bloom filter

The bloom layer in front of the Pellet KV store is rejecting all lookups in staging because the env file was copied from the dev template without credentials. False-positive tuning values are fine; only the auth line is missing. To unblock the weekly demo, the Pellet admission secret must be set on the following line.

env line for yaguf-fajop: LEDGER_TOKEN13=fb08984397349

## Runbook: Hermet build migration — what support needs to know

We're moving the Quillfort build off the old shell scripts onto Hermet, our hermetic build system. Short version: builds are now reproducible, caches are shared, and "works on my machine" tickets should drop. During the transition, some customers on old agents will see checksum warnings — harmless, point them to the migration FAQ. If a build fails, first check the agent is running with the following settings.

config for taguf-tafof:
zorath:
  log_level: error
  metrics_host: metrics.zorath.zemvarlabs.internal
  pin: 5550
  pool_size: 32